Subject: DR drill for FeedCheck validator — Thursday

Hi plugin authors,

On Thursday we will run a disaster-recovery drill for the FeedCheck podcast feed validator. Expect the validation API to fail over to the standby cluster for roughly twenty minutes; plugin submissions will queue automatically. No action is needed on your side. If you must restore a sandbox tenant during the window, use the passphrase below.

recovery phrase for hahop-bajeg: kasok-fenath-ulays-drudor-belael-aldath-druion

Ticket: Autocomplete on the Fernwick catalog search takes 900ms at p95. Root cause: prefix index rebuilt on every keystroke batch. Fix: cache the trie snapshot, rebuild async every 30s. Benchmarks attached; p95 drops to 40ms. No schema changes. Needs sign-off before merge to release branch. Approver of record is listed below.

account owner for bawip-tahag: Raleth Quenok

## Deployment

The GarageSense occupancy feed runs as a single worker on the Deckwatch cluster. It polls each garage gateway every thirty seconds and publishes counts to the shared bus. Deploys go through the standard Ferrow pipeline; no manual steps are needed beyond a config check. Before promoting a build, confirm the service starts with the following configuration values.

service settings:
[casax]
port = 6379
team = rusir
host = casax.zemvarhq.corp
region = outer-4
access_code = ac_9808ce
timeout_ms = 1500

// Security note: all third-party font files under assets/fonts are vendored,
// never fetched at build or run time, to keep the supply chain auditable.
// Each file was verified against the upstream checksum manifest before
// inclusion, and licenses are recorded in FONT_LICENSES.md. Do not add a
// font without updating both the manifest and the license record. The
// constant below pins the manifest version we validated. The verification
// run's trace token is recorded immediately below.

build token for yajof-bajof: htk31_506ff1188f74596b5bb2eec94edc43c